Abstract

Mineral processing plants include different stages like crushing, grinding, classification and concentration, all of which have partially affect the final product. To identify and solve the related problems of each stage, process audition should be carried out continuously to find the major solutions of improving product and decreasing the maintenance and operating costs. The Iranian Gohar-Zamin iron ore beneficiation plant consists of equipment such as gyratory and cone crushers, high pressure grinding rolls (HPGR), ball mill, dry and wet double-deck vibrating screens, hydrocyclones cluster, magnetic drum separators, thickener and horizontal vacuum belt filters. The defects of initial design as well as current non-standard operating conditions of equipment were monitored and detected and the opportunities for process optimisation were presented as follows: establishing the control loop of power draw for cone crushers, the modification of feeding chute in cone crushers to minimise the non-uniform wear of parts, removing segregation in the fresh feed bin and screen’s circulating load chute in order to provide the proper feed to HPGR, reducing wear rate on HPGR rolls surfaces, decreasing the amount of rejected materials in screen, equalising the solid content and particle size distribution (PSD) of feed in all magnetic drum separators and equalising the PSD of hydrocyclones overflow. This paper provides a guideline for the mineral processing industry to focus its efforts on process design to deliver the efficiency with minimum capital costs.
